I've been having a few problems with my 3970 over the last couple of months and yesterday I suddenly realised they might be linked. They range from a Sat Nav program I have losing the signal to my GPS unit to my Theme Dream stopping changing themes to Journal Bar not scrolling through it's contents even though it is configured to and Active Synch hanging. There's more but you get the picture.

When all of these things happen they can usually be resolved by shutting the app down although occassionally I need to do a soft reset. However I am still able to use other aspects of the PPC until I realise the problem is happening.

Yesterday I thought these are all kind of similar and it is as if something is stopping certain processes from happening in the background but letting other stuff work. I did a hard reset a couple of weeks ago and installed software one by one and it started happening almost straight away. I called HP about it but they have warned me there will be a charge if there turns out to be nothing wrong. I've also done a Google search without any decent results.

So my question is does anyone know if this is a known problem or have they experienced it themselves. Secondly are there are diagnostic programs that might be able to detect any hardware problems on my unit.
